## v2.9.0 — Setting renamed

The deep-link routing flag `LINKHOP_ROUTE_MODE` is now `LINKHOP_DEEPLINK_STRATEGY` to match the mobile SDK naming in Brightquill's app shell. Old name is read for one release, then removed. Routing signatures are still verified server-side before redirect. Add the new name to your env file, followed by the signing secret on the next line.

env line for fafof-fahag: LEDGER_TOKEN5=f8790

Tables in Shardloom are partitioned by calendar month on `event_ts`; queries must include a month predicate or the planner scans all partitions. New partitions are created by the `partctl` endpoint three days before month start. Maintainers calling `partctl` directly must authenticate against the internal Shardloom admin API with the standing key, which is included here for reference.

gateway credential: kto3_qfe

### Escalation — Password Reset Revamp (Project Keyturn)

If users report reset links failing after the Keyturn rollout, first confirm whether they're on the legacy or revamped flow (check the `flow_version` field in the ticket). Legacy failures go to the identity queue; revamped-flow failures escalate directly to the Keyturn team within 30 minutes. Do not re-send reset links manually. Include the ticket number and flow version when escalating, and send the details to the address below.

escalation mailbox, fawep-tahop: quenvan@nelvrostack.internal

Context: PaySlice moved payroll exports from the legacy fixed-width format to the new column-delimited format in release 9.2. The export signing account locks if three malformed files are submitted during cutover. Recovery steps: confirm lockout in the audit log, verify the last good export checksum, then re-enable the account via the recovery console. Do not regenerate keys; that invalidates prior exports. Approval from the payroll lead is required before unlock. The console prompts for the recovery passphrase shown below.

unlock words, fahop-yageg: ralwyn-kelath